Apple Delays Home Hub With Magnetic Mount Feature

Apple is delaying its iPad-like smart home hub (codename J490) until later this year, reportedly pushing an earlier launch to fall, Bloomberg’s Mark Gurman and others report. Sources attribute the postponement to unfinished Siri and Apple Intelligence integrations—Siri improvements now targeted for iOS 26.5 and a fuller chatbot in iOS 27. Leaks also suggest a MagSafe snap-to-wall mount and facial-recognition features.
